What Is Chat Blackbox AI?

Chat Blackbox AI is an advanced conversational AI platform that uses machine learning, natural language processing (NLP), and data analysis to engage in human-like conversations. It differs from conventional chatbots in that it can comprehend context, learn from conversations, and respond with pertinent information.

How Chat Blackbox AI Works

Natural Language Processing (NLP) at Its Core

Natural Language Processing (NLP) at Its Core

NLP is the backbone of Chat Blackbox AI, allowing it to interpret and respond to human language naturally. By analyzing the structure of sentences, it understands not just the words, but the intent behind them.

Understanding User Intent

Understanding what the user wants is one of Chat Blackbox AI’s main advantages. Whether it’s a question, a request for information, or a specific task, the AI can decipher the intent and provide a relevant response.

Contextual Awareness in Conversations

Chat Blackbox AI remembers past interactions and uses this context to deliver more meaningful conversations. It doesn’t just respond to isolated queries but builds on previous interactions to maintain continuity.

Machine Learning and Data Analysis

Continuous improvement of Chat Blackbox AI is made possible by machine learning. It learns from each conversation, becoming more adept at understanding user preferences, and behavior patterns, and how to respond more effectively over time.

Continuous Learning and Improvement

As users interact with the system, Chat Blackbox AI refines its algorithms, making each conversation better than the last. This constant evolution ensures that it remains relevant and useful in various contexts.

Applications of Chat Blackbox AI Tools

Applications of Chat Blackbox AI

Enhancing Customer Support

Customer service is one of Chat Blackbox AI’s most well-known applications. It enables businesses to respond to inquiries quickly and accurately, improving customer satisfaction while reducing the need for human intervention.

Revolutionizing E-Commerce Experiences

In e-commerce, Chat Blackbox AI can act as a virtual shopping assistant, guiding customers through their purchasing journey, answering questions about products, and providing personalized recommendations based on browsing history and preferences.

Personal Assistants for Productivity

Chat Blackbox AI can also function as a personal assistant, helping individuals stay organized, set reminders, schedule appointments, and manage tasks more efficiently.

Educational Support Systems

In the education sector, Chat Blackbox AI can support students by answering questions, providing resources, and offering tutoring assistance. It can also help teachers by automating administrative tasks like grading or scheduling.

AI in Healthcare

In healthcare, Chat Blackbox AI is being used to provide preliminary diagnoses, schedule appointments, and offer patient support. It can also remind patients to take medications or follow up on treatments.

Limitations:

Black box nature: The actual AI model is a black box hence challenging to understand its rationality and debug the errors.

Potential for code errors: The generated code, though it is working, may not be optimal or efficient, and so needs a review before modification.

Less transparency regarding training data; no further information is available about the precise data the Blackbox AI was trained on, which is a limitation for trust and understanding of the biases.

The actual architecture of Blackbox AI

Architecture:

The actual architecture of Blackbox AI is unknown, perhaps for strategic reasons-trying to preserve intellectual property and prevent some form of improper use. However, based on its functionalities and the available information in public domain, we can hazard some educated guesses about its underlying technology:

Natural Language Processing (NLP):

    A robust NLP component likely converts user descriptions into a structured internal representation that the model can read.

    This could be accompanied by techniques such as tokenization, part-of-speech tagging, and semantic parsing to infer important ideas and relationships in the user’s text.

    Code Generation:

      The core of Blackbox likely rests in the form of a machine learning model trained on a mammoth dataset of code together with natural language descriptions accompanying it.

      This model probably applies techniques such as transformer architectures or conditional generative adversarial networks (GANs) in learning the mapping between natural language and corresponding code structures.

      Then, the model would generate code snippets based on the internal representation provided by the NLP module.

      Support of Multiple Programming Languages:

        The support of multiple languages has indicated that Blackbox takes a modular architecture with language-specific adapters.

        These translators likely use the internal representation and translate it into code specific to a particular language’s syntax and semantics.

        Image Integration with Code File:

          The image and code file analysis functionalities could probably include modules with special capabilities.

          For image to code, OCRs and parsing of the code syntax would be most appropriate

          Code file analysis might involve static code analysis and techniques in the representation of a program in other abstractions that enable one to understand how the existing code is structured and functions.

          Chatbot Interaction:

            The natural language understanding and generation capabilities would be largely applied for the chatbot interaction module so that it could converse with users in a proper conversational manner.

            Challenges and Limitations

            Overcoming Language Barriers

            While Blackbox AI is multilingual, it may still struggle with regional dialects or less common languages. Continuous updates are necessary to expand its language capabilities.

            Managing User Expectations

            Users may expect AI to fully understand complex emotions or tasks. While Chat Blackbox AI is highly advanced, there are still limitations in handling highly nuanced or emotional conversations.

            Addressing Technical Limitations

            Like all technologies, Blackbox AI has its technical limitations, such as handling highly complex tasks or managing unique requests that fall outside its programming.

            FAQs

            What industries can benefit the most from Chat Blackbox AI?

            Industries like customer service, healthcare, e-commerce, and education can significantly benefit from Chat Blackbox AI by automating responses and improving efficiency.

            How does Chat Blackbox AI handle complex conversations?

            Chat Blackbox AI uses natural language processing and contextual memory to understand the flow of conversations and provide relevant, personalized responses.

            Can Chat Blackbox AI fully replace human interactions?

            While Chat Blackbox AI can handle many tasks, it is not a complete replacement for human interactions, especially when empathy or complex problem-solving is required.

            What are the risks involved in using AI for communication?

            Some risks include data privacy concerns, potential response biases, and limitations in understanding human emotions or very complex tasks.

            How does Blackbox AI differ from traditional chatbots?

            Unlike traditional chatbots, Chat Blackbox AI uses advanced NLP and machine learning to provide more human-like, dynamic conversations that adapt to user inputs over time.
